Brochure introducing Old-age and Survivors Insurance - Social Security - Monthly Benefits Begin in 1940

US Government Printing Office, 1939. 8 pp pamphlet with an image from a photograph of gently "puffing his chest". The content describes the monthly old-age and survivor's insurance benefits beginning January 1, 1940. It describes how to qualify - retire from work, or made at least $50 in each of 6 calendar quarters since 1936. It further explains that wages you earned after 65 years would count towards benefits and how the program worked for surviving spouses and children. Monthly benefits were based on previous earnings.
